Josh Abrams
 |
Josh Abrams has a love of music that has been seen and heard on
dancefloors around the world for the past fifteen years. The Los
Angeles native brought Santa Monica its longest-running progressive
house music night (PURE @ Club Sugar); not only as resident DJ, but by
bringing in some of the best talent (known and unknown) from around
the globe. The popularity of PURE led to subsequent residencies with
Spundae L.A., Traffic Events (L.A.) and Qool L.A. Josh began appearing
regularly as a guest DJ on Groove Radio's most popular show, "Tsunami"
hosted by Dave Dresden (formerly of Gabriel & Dresden), in addition to
hosting his weekly show "Elysium" on Protonradio.com. Josh Abrams's
seamless, creative mixing and impeccable track selection along with
his signature high-energy, bash attitude has charmed feverish crowds
from Vancouver, Canada to Hamburg, Germany. Josh currently resides in
Las Vegas where his recent residencies have included Risque inside the
Paris Hotel & Casino, Eye Candy Sound Lounge inside Mandalay Bay,
Cherry Nightclub, Lucky Bar and T-Bones at the Red Rock Resort and
Casino, Asia Nightclub inside Planet Hollywood and Puff Lounge as well
as playing for sold out crowds at many other top notch venues like
Godskitchen @ Body English, Rok Vegas, Empire Ballroom and Prive
Nightclub. Josh's production career is just blossoming and already
receiving rave reviews. Keep on the lookout for his remix work
forthcoming on some major labels very soon! The newest addition to a
constantly growing resume is his new show on friskyRadio.com, Brown
Paper Bag, where Josh features a new 2 hour mix of the best in dance

Android Cartel
 |
ver the past five years Android Cartel has had many successes with their foray into the sacred art of dance music. First picked up by veteran's Chris Fortier and Steve Lawler in 2008, Android Cartel came onto the scene with great passion and enthusiasm and was soon being played by all the top dogs. From Luciano to John Digweed, Android Cartel's beats could be heard on the radio and in the club.
Since that first inception the boys have had a slow rise into the consciousness of dance music culture. Landing remixes and releases on respected labels such as Rawthentic Music, Thoughtless Music, Spark, ViVa Music, and more recently on the highly acclaimed Adjunct Audio, it is with great enthusiasm that Android Cartel has blazed their own path while effortlessly seeking to improve on their grooves and sound.
Their label Sketchbook Audio has also been a consistent source for breeding various shades of techno and subsequently making their own music family in the process, the boys have seen their own imprint being supported and played by some of the biggest players in the business including Len Faki, Secret Cinema, Joel Mull, Carlo Lio and many, many more.
Besides their production and label escapades, Android Cartel has built up a solid reputation in Southern California as an incredible and articulate DJ duo, and have performed at many of the legendary festivals in the area such as Lightning In a Bottle, Electric Daisy Carnival, Beyond Wonderland, and Escape From Wonderland. They have also been in consistent demand from LA's promoters and have played parties and events for Droid Behavior, Harmonic, Incognito, and have recently acquired a residency at LA's longest running club night, Monday Social.
